Have you ever heard of Spleeter Deezer? Spleeter Deezer is an AI source separation engine developed by Deezer R&D team to separate audio tracks. Thanks to innovative and outperforming Artificial intelligence, we’re able to separate the voice and different musical instruments of a song with ease. Spleeter is MIT-Licensed so you are really free to use it in any way you want. So, if you’re a music hacker who wants to build something great with Deezer Spleeter, then go ahead!
As for now, still, lots of people have puzzled about how this tool work and how to install Spleeter Deezer on our devices. Here comes the solution! We will write you useful tips to help you separate audio tracks and enjoy Deezer better.
Part 1. Overview of Spleeter by Deezer
In case many of you have little understanding of Spleeter, we will first introduce it in the first part. You can read the following content to get the information you need.
What is Spleeter Deezer?
Since the issue of source separation has been a long-time discovering project, there are multiple needs and future applications with audio separation. Deezer has made much research on this topic and designed this efficient tool. Spleeter by Deezer is an open-source audio separation tool, that allows users to isolate different elements of a song, such as vocals, bass, drums, and other instruments, with remarkable accuracy. Both professionals and hobbyists can access and use it with ease.
Main features of Spleeter Deezer
Well, in short, Deezer Spleeter is a solution for recreating multi-tracks from a flat audio file, whether for a song, podcast, movie, game, etc. In terms of main features, it can be divided into the following several types:
- Perform audio restoration or remastering
- Generate karaoke or music-learning tracks
- Generate multi-tracks for DJ mixes
- Simplify subtitling activities
- Create bespoke audio-centric experiences
Besides, after pre-training, Deezer has 3 different modes depending on your desire or need.
- 2 Stems: Voice + all instruments
- 4 Stems: Vocals + Drums + Bass + Others
- 5 Stems: Vocals + Drums + Bass + Piano + Others
How We Use It at Deezer
In general cases, Deezer Spleeter is available on your desktop no matter what your operating system is. For more advanced users, there is a Python API class called Separator that you can manipulate directly into your usual pipeline. At Deezer, we use Spleeter on a day-to-day basis to separate vocal and instrumental tracks. The innovation program is Python code and you need to install it from Github, a software developer website.
Part 2. How to Use Spleeter Deezer on PC
Spleeter is an open-source separation library with pre-trained models written in Python and uses Tensorflow. There is no direct application download in the App Store, you’ll have to download it via github.com as they are only created by Python codes. When it comes to installing Deezer Spleeter on your PC, several choices are available for you. Please note that Spleeter by Deezer now no longer supports installing from Conda and will not recommend you use this way.
2.1 How to Install Spleeter Deezer
The simplest method is still to use “pip” with a “ffmpeg” dependency. Before installing Spleeter directly from the Pip package manager, please make sure the following dependencies are installed in advance.
- Ffmpeg
- Libsndfile
These dependencies can be installed with conda on any platform.
conda install -c conda-forge ffmpeg libsndfile
You can then install the library from PyPi repository:
pip install spleeter
2.2 Use Deezer Spleeter with Commands
Once installed, Spleeter can be used directly from any CLI through the spleeter command. As for the main features, Spleeter provides you three actions with the following subcommand.
Command | Description |
---|---|
Separate | Separate audio files using a pre-trained model |
Train | Train a source separation model. You need a dataset of separated tracks to use it |
Evaluate | Pretrained model evaluation over the musDB test set |
2.3 Use Deezer Spleeter Online
Want to try it out while are not willing to install anything? No problem! Spleeter Deezer has set up a Google Colab for your online experience. The simple tutorial is as below.
Step 1. Navigate to Google Colab from colab.research.google.com.
Step 2. Follow the on-screen instructions to get Spleeter online.
Step 3. Get the example mp3 file from Deezer Spleeter Github.
Step 4. Separate the audio file from command line.
With the above steps, you can utilize Spleeter to do multiple kinds of things, including remixing, upmixing, active listening, educational purposes, and more. Well, Deezer has also claimed that if you plan to use Spleeter on copyrighted materials like Deezer tracks, you must get proper authorization from the authors beforehand.
Part 3. Bonus: How to Separate Music without Spleeter by Deezer
Though Spleeter Deezer was designated by Deezer officials, it was finally released as an open-source audio separation tool for public usage. Its functions may not be able to meet all your demands. If you have a better tool for separating music, you can also import your favorite Deezer tracks to that tool and edit them as you wish. In such a case, you may be blocked from doing so due to the DRM protection of Deezer music. It is known that streaming content is regarded as copyrighted material. Thus, you can not download or play them out of the Deezer app. To break this limitation, you will need the help of a music converter – Tunelf Deezer Music Converter.
Tunelf Deezer Music Converter is specially designed for all Deezer users to enjoy Deezer Music better without limits. It lets you download songs, playlists, albums, podcasts, and radios from Deezer to MP3, AAC, and more with HiFi quality. For playing Deezer music without limitations, you can easily convert and download Deezer music to MP3, AAC, FLAC, and other popular audio formats. Plus, the 100% audio quality and ID3 tags will be losslessly retained. After conversion, it’s easy to import local mp3 files to anywhere or any device for streaming or something else.
Key Features of Tunelf Deezer Music Converter
- Keep Deezer songs with the lossless audio quality and ID3 tags
- Remove DRM and ads from Deezer music after the conversion
- Download Deezer songs, albums, playlists, podcasts, and radios
- Convert Deezer music tracks to MP3, FLAC, and more in batch
- Freely customize lots of parameters like format, bit rate, and channel
For users who want to import the Deezer tracks to other applications for separating, here is a comprehensive tutorial. You just need to follow the steps below and you can get Deezer songs as local DRM-free files.
Step 1
Import target Deezer songs to the Tunelf software
To start with, you need to click the download button above to install the Tunelf Deezer Music Converter on your desktop. According to the operating system of your computer, you can choose to install the Windows version or the Mac version. Then, you can launch the Tunelf software by double-clicking its icon. It will help you open the Deezer app at the same time. Next, you should locate the songs you want to download and drag and drop them to the interface of the Tunelf software. So, these songs will be imported successfully.
Step 2
Reset the output settings
The Tunelf software allows you to personalize your music experience by resetting the audio settings. Just click the menu icon at the top right, then choose Preferences. After that, switch to the Convert tab. Here you can set the audio settings as you wish. The changeable options include output format, channel, bit rate, sample rate, and so on. When you finish your settings, don’t forget to click OK so that your personalized settings can be saved.
Step 3
Begin downloading and converting Deezer songs
To start the downloading process, you just need to click the Convert button which is located at the right bottom of Tunelf’s interface. How long it takes depends on the number of songs you added. Once done, the downloaded music files will be stored in the local folder of your computer automatically. You can click the Converted icon to find them.
Part 4. Conclusion
To conclude, Spleeter Deezer is a useful tool for music remixes and more. But the process to install can be a bit difficult and you’ll need to figure out the Python codes and download them from GitHub. In addition to that, if you want to download Deezer music for remix, Tunelf Deezer Music Converter is the best tool to achieve.
Get the product now:
Get the product now: